Amakhosi travel to Morocco with confidence─── 16:30 Wed, 01 Apr 2015
Premier Soccer League leaders, Kaizer Chiefs have departed for Morocco in high spirits ahead of their CAF Champions League first round second leg match against Raja Casablanca.
The Amakhosi however have a tough task on their hands as they look to overturn a 1-0 deficit from the first leg played at the FNB Stadium in Soweto.
Amakhosi went into the international break last week on the back of an unexpected exit from the Nedbank Cup and will be doubly determined to bounce back against Raja.
Back home the club are still well on track to win the PSL next month, however champions Mamelodi Sundowns and bitter-rivals Orlando Pirates are still breathing down their necks.
Sunday evening’s clash at the Mohammed the fifth stadium kicks off at 21:00.
